Here is precisely what I had to do to get zones to boot up in 1.9...don't ask me what this is a symptom of, but, this is how it went....

Using a fresh install, fresh DB, everything. My world would launch up fine. My zones would initialize saying using db eq at 127.0.0.1 then just totally disappear, never connecting to the world server.

I logged in with my client as far as the world server, and created a character. I fired up the eqadmintool went into modify the new acct to set him as server op and give him a password. When I went to commit that change the first time, I got a pop up that said something along the lines of "DB not in insert mode", I pressed commit again and it took the change fine.

THEN I fired up the boot5zones.bat and they all connected to the world server and fired up corrrectly.

It looks to me like for some reason the zones were not able to connect to the DB until after I commited the change to the DB and got passed that "DB not in insert mode" error.
